LSUA vs. Lander University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, LSUA or Lander University?

  • Lander University is 116.2% more expensive to attend than LSUA for in-state tuition ($10,700.00 vs. $4,950.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 296.5% higher at Lander University than Louisiana State University Alexandria ($20,300.00 vs. $5,120.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Louisiana State University Alexandria than Lander University ($8,081 vs. $14,657)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Louisiana State University Alexandria are 11.5% lower than costs at Lander University ($9,598 vs. $10,700)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Lander University than Louisiana State University Alexandria (98% vs. 89%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Lander University students is 74.6% larger than aid received Louisiana State University Alexandria ($12,000 vs. $6,874)

LSUA vs. Lander University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, LSUA or Lander University?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Lander University and LSUA.

  • The graduation rate at Lander University is higher than Louisiana State University Alexandria (37% vs. 12%)
  • Graduates from Lander University earn on average $1,300 more per year than LSUA graduates after ten years. ($37,000 vs. $35,700)
  • Louisiana State University Alexandria students graduate with a $9,293 lower median federal student loan debt than Lander University graduates. ($17,707 vs. $27,000)
  • LSUA graduates are paying $96 less per month on federal student loans than Lander University graduates. ($183 vs. $279)
